Mauritanian Ahmed Yahya announced his candidacy for the presidency of the African Football Confederation (CAF) on November 9, 2020. He answered RFI's questions on Tuesday, November 17.

Find new sources of income for CAF

Without wishing to dwell on the results of the Ahmad presidency, Yahya wants to " 

make football grow

 " on the African continent and even dreams of an African team in the final of the World Cup.

He also wants to develop women's football and expects structured clubs.

“ 

We have to work to find new sources of income for CAF.

If I am elected, I will work to increase support for the federations.

Thanks to new ideas, I multiplied by 20 the income of my Federation.

I do not promise to multiply CAF income by 20!

But I will make sure to increase them significantly,

 ”he says.  

Elected president of the FFRIM in 2011 at only 35 years old, Ahmed Yahya then embarked on a vast construction site for the Mauritanian round ball.

Upon arrival, the national A team was in 190th place in the ranking of nations.

In 2013, Mauritania qualified for the 2014 African Nations Championship (CHAN 2014).

After failing to qualify for CHAN 2016, the Mourabitounes participate in CHAN 2018 and especially in their first African Cup of Nations in 2019.

Support from Uganda, Mali and Djibouti

“ 

I have the support of my Federation but also of Uganda, Mali and Djibouti.

Other federations have already indicated their support to me.

The campaign has only just begun,

 ”announces Ahmed Yahya, who is said to be close to Fifa.

“ 

Fifa should not support a candidate.

Infantino came to inaugurate projects financed by Fifa in Mauritania as part of Goal-Fifa.

I have a good relationship with Fifa, but we have to think for ourselves for the sake of African football.

I am not Ahmad's plan B or the Fifa candidate

 , ”says Ahmed Yahya.

About a CAN every four years strongly desired by Fifa, Ahmed Yahya first wants to consult the whole continent before making a decision.

“ 

We have to see if it's worth changing the frequency of the ADC.

A change can only be possible if it benefits African football

 ”.

Three candidates from the same region in the presidential race Is it a problem for Ahmed Yahya?

“ 

No I don't think so.

There should not be a question of rivalry between regions.

We have to judge each other's program first of all.

I am a man of action and I carry an inclusive project for Africa.

This is what drives me,

 ”he concludes.
